• su: 切换用户


    切换指定的用户

    [root@salt-server-192 ~]# su - www
    [www@salt-server-192 ~]$ 

    切换root用户

    [www@salt-server-192 ~]$ su
    密码:
    [root@salt-server-192 www]# 

    su -  切换root用户并且shell环境也切换到root

    [root@salt-server-192 ~]# su - www
    [www@salt-server-192 ~]$ echo $PATH
    /usr/local/bin:/bin:/usr/bin:/usr/local/sbin:/usr/sbin:/sbin:/home/www/bin
    [www@salt-server-192 ~]$ su 
    密码:
    [root@salt-server-192 www]# echo $PATH
    /usr/local/bin:/bin:/usr/bin:/usr/local/sbin:/usr/sbin:/sbin:/home/www/bin
    [root@salt-server-192 www]# su - www
    [www@salt-server-192 ~]$ su - 
    密码: 
    [root@salt-server-192 ~]# echo $PATH
    /us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/root/bin

    su 和su - 区别:

      su只是切换了root身份,但shel环境仍然是普通用户的shell,而su - 用户和shell环境一起切换成root了

    用echo $PATH命令看一下su 和su - 后的环境变量

    建议使用 su -

  • 相关阅读:
    9.17考试
    Something
    tesuto-Mobius
    7.22考试
    填坑...P1546 最短网络 Agri-Net
    P1125 笨小猴
    P2822 组合数问题
    致我们曾经刷过的水题
    Luogu P1186 玛丽卡
    Luogu P1726 上白泽慧音
  • 原文地址:https://www.cnblogs.com/mingerlcm/p/7880472.html
Copyright © 2020-2023  润新知